Villager of the Year

There are many people who steadfastly work quietly away to ensure that tasks in and around Meare and Westhay are completed. Others dedicate many hours of their time to ensure that the organisations and activities of the parish continue to the benefit of others. Some people are simply great neighbours, looking out to the needs of the elderly and infirm, providing care support, running errands or simply being there with a shoulder to cry on. Why not acknowledge the enormous value of those who do so much for our parish and nominate them for the Villager of the Year award. There are a few guidelines and rules to follow when nominating someone. They are:

Nominated people must live in the parish
Parish Councillors cannot be nominated
The award is for an individual, not an organisation or business.
Applications are to be supported by a short statement as to why this person is considered worthy of an award.
